Recorded after he overcame his heroin habit, 461 Ocean Boulevard contains Clapton's biggest solo single, 'I Shot the Sheriff', which reached #1 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art.
Rough Mix was released in September 1977 while the Who were on hiatus. It was a collaboration with Small Faces bassist Ronnie Lane and features contributions from Who bassist John Entwistle, Eric Clapton and Rolling Stones drummer Charlie Watts.
